What to Look for in Botanical Extract Manufacturers
Not all botanical extract manufacturers operate at the same level of quality and reliability. When evaluating potential partners, start with these fundamental criteria:
R&D Capability and Scientific Expertise: A reputable manufacturer should have an in-house research and development team staffed with experts in phytochemistry, pharmacology, and related disciplines. Look for manufacturers that collaborate with academic institutions and maintain dedicated laboratories for standardization, bioavailability optimization, and new product development. Companies backed by PhDs, professors, and experienced researchers are far more likely to deliver consistent, scientifically validated extracts.
Advanced Extraction Technology: The extraction method directly affects the purity, potency, and safety of the final product. Leading manufacturers employ multiple extraction techniques — including water extraction, alcohol extraction, and supercritical CO₂ extraction — and select the optimal method based on each botanical's unique phytochemical profile. This technological versatility ensures that active compounds are preserved at their highest possible concentrations.
Quality Control Systems: Comprehensive quality control should span the entire production chain: raw material authentication at intake, in-process monitoring during extraction, active compound verification at completion, and microbial testing before release. Ask potential suppliers about their testing protocols and whether they maintain detailed batch records for full traceability.
Global Supply Chain and Sourcing: The best botanical extracts begin with the best raw materials. A strong manufacturer maintains a robust sourcing network with botanical authentication protocols and sustainability practices. This ensures not only quality but also supply continuity — a critical factor when you are scaling production.
The Value of Proprietary Herbal Formulas and OEM Services
Beyond single-ingredient extracts, many supplement brands are now differentiating themselves through proprietary herbal formulas — unique, science-backed blends that address specific health concerns. Working with a manufacturer that offers both standardized single extracts and proprietary formula development gives you a significant competitive advantage.
A full-service herbal extract manufacturer should provide turnkey OEM and private label services, covering everything from concept development and formulation to manufacturing and packaging. This end-to-end approach eliminates the need to coordinate multiple vendors, reduces time to market, and ensures consistency across every stage of production. When evaluating OEM partners, consider whether they offer diverse product formats — capsules, tablets, instant powders, granulated extracts, beverage powders, and functional ingredient blends — as this flexibility allows you to expand your product portfolio without switching suppliers.
Key Takeaway: A manufacturer that combines raw material expertise with finished product capabilities is a strategic partner, not just a vendor. This integrated model supports faster innovation cycles and tighter quality control from farm to finished bottle.
Product Diversity: Meeting the Full Spectrum of Market Demand
The health supplement market spans multiple categories — dietary supplements, functional foods, functional beverages, cosmetics, and even pharmaceutical applications. Your botanical ingredient supplier should have the product breadth to support your ambitions across these categories. A comprehensive portfolio might include standardized herbal extracts (such as ashwagandha, ginkgo biloba, and milk thistle), functional mushroom extracts (like lion's mane, reishi, and cordyceps), natural food colors, and specialized formulations targeting areas such as immune support, cognitive health, metabolic wellness, and sleep quality.
Additionally, look for manufacturers that offer ingredients in various standardized potencies and multiple formats. This versatility allows you to tailor your formulations precisely to your target market and dosage requirements, whether you are producing capsules for the North American market, beverage powders for Europe, or cosmetic ingredients for Asia.
Scalability and Global Reach
Your supplier should be able to grow with you. A manufacturer that serves markets across North America, Europe, and Asia demonstrates the logistical capability and regulatory knowledge to support international expansion. Evaluate their production capacity, lead times, and ability to handle both small-batch trial orders and large-scale commercial production. The right partner will have cooperative relationships with specialized extraction facilities that can scale output without compromising quality.
